The Buck 303 Cadet is the little brother to the 301 Stockman model, and is a traditional folder pattern with multiple blades for a wide variety of uses. It features 3 distinctly shaped stainless steel blades. The clip point is good for detail work, the spey blade is good for skinning and sweeping knife strokes, and the sheepsfoot gets a clean cut against flat surfaces. Blade Material: 420HC Stainless steel Mechanism: Slip Joint Pocket Clip: none Handle Material: Black Valox, nickel bolsters Closed Length: 3.25" Blade Length: Clip 2.25"                         Spey 1.5"                         Sheepsfoot 1.5" Weight: 1.9 oz Buck Knives is a 4th generation family run company based in Post Falls, Idaho. They’ve maintained a loyal following over the years, thanks to consistent workmanship and high quality materials.
